Oxford United Youth team lost 6-1 to a very strong Stevenage Borough youth
team last night at Court Place Farm, The U's were 4-0 down at half time and
to be honest it could have been a lot worse, Stevenage got 3 of their goals in quick
succession after taking the lead from a bullet of a header.....
On average though the Oxford Boys were nearly 2 years a lad younger than them,
They did gain a bit of experience from this and the Fireworks around the
ground were superb.

Oxford could be without Steve Basham tomorrow at Layer Road, Bash's Leg and
foot are still pretty sore and bashed up, he is rated doubtful, but you never know he might make an appearance, He got the injury whilst playing against Darlington last weekend
and is not the only injury doubt,  Danny Brown is a worry too, he was/is set to replace
the suspended Matt Robinson, but that could be all changed.

Sunday 2nd November 2003
Thankfully the U's found their form in the 2nd half yesterday after going in at
half time 1-0 down after McGurk scored for Darlington.
Superb sub Mark Rawle got the U's equalizer after good work by Man of the
Match Dean Whitehead, He scooped the ball across to Rawle who was waiting
inside the 6 yard box to slot into an empty net, from then on it looked like the
U's were going to run riot-and they did when the U's won a free kick outside
the area as Chrissy Hackett was brought down, Super Deano rounded the
wall with his usual technique and the U's were in the lead, by then the U's were
playing against 10 men after Darlington's Mellanby was sent off for lumping
Woody one just inside the keepers area, that was not the end of it as they then
 had their goal scorer McGurk sent off too and finished the game with 9 players.
Then just to round off a great fight back at the end Paul Wanless got a 3rd
and the U's crowd went from disappointment in the 1st to delirium in the 2nd,
But there was better news at the final whistle as Macclesfield had got an
equalizer on 90 minutes at Hull to make it 2-2, so we are only 2 points from
them now, level with Doncaster on 34 points, yesterday was the first time that
